From 43b7aa757b2efddda01ef5437f265bf7da035e13 Mon Sep 17 00:00:00 2001 From: shijingjing <1789544664@qq.com> Date: Wed, 15 Mar 2023 16:51:26 +0800 Subject: [PATCH] =?UTF-8?q?=E5=8F=82=E6=95=B0=E5=AD=98=E6=9C=AC=E5=9C=B0?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- src/project/qujing/AppHome/AppHome.vue | 7 +++++-- .../qujing/AppLegalLearning/AppLegalLearning.vue | 10 +++++----- 2 files changed, 10 insertions(+), 7 deletions(-) diff --git a/src/project/qujing/AppHome/AppHome.vue b/src/project/qujing/AppHome/AppHome.vue index d3910f4..c55eb9a 100644 --- a/src/project/qujing/AppHome/AppHome.vue +++ b/src/project/qujing/AppHome/AppHome.vue @@ -167,8 +167,11 @@ export default { } }, clickLaw(index) { - uni.relaunch({ - url: '/pages/AppLegalLearning/AppLegalLearning?inx=' + index + uni.switchTab({ + url: '/pages/AppLegalLearning/AppLegalLearning', + success: ()=> { + uni.setStorageSync('inx', index) + } }) }, handleActive({type, appId, url}) { diff --git a/src/project/qujing/AppLegalLearning/AppLegalLearning.vue b/src/project/qujing/AppLegalLearning/AppLegalLearning.vue index 1590e01..206451f 100644 --- a/src/project/qujing/AppLegalLearning/AppLegalLearning.vue +++ b/src/project/qujing/AppLegalLearning/AppLegalLearning.vue @@ -35,6 +35,9 @@ export default { } }, onShow() { + if(uni.getStorageSync('inx')) { + this.currIndex = uni.getStorageSync('inx') + } if(this.currIndex == 0) { this.$refs.OnlineClass.getList(); } else { @@ -47,11 +50,8 @@ export default { } }); }, - onLoad(o) { - if(o) { - console.log(o); - this.currIndex = o.inx - } + onUnload() { + uni.removeStorageSync('inx') }, components: { OnlineClass,